name: ivar_trim
description: Trim primer sequences rom a BAM file with iVar
keywords:
- amplicon sequencing
- trimming
- fasta
tools:
- ivar:
description: |
iVar - a computational package that contains functions broadly useful for viral amplicon-based sequencing.
homepage: https://github.com/andersen-lab/ivar
documentation: https://andersen-lab.github.io/ivar/html/manualpage.html

input:
- meta:
type: map
description: |
Groovy Map containing sample information
e.g. [ id:'test', single_end:false ]
- bam:
type: file
description: A sorted (with samtools sort) bam file
pattern: "*.bam"
- bed:
type: file
description: BED file with primer labels and positions
pattern: "*.bed"
